EU member countries in brief

Bulgaria, Capital: Sofia; Official EU languages: Bulgarian; EU member country: since 1 January 2007; Currency: Bulgarian lev BGN, Bulgaria has committed to adopt the euro once it fulfils the necessary conditions, Schengen: Bulgaria is currently in the process of joining the Schengen area,

Golden Bulgaria

Bulgaria in the EU – positive aspects, Bulgarians hold 10 votes in the EU Council the same number as Austria and Sweden and has 17 members in the European Parliament, Since joining the EU, Bulgaria has been actively involved in the processes of EU policy making, Thanks to that, the profile of Bulgaria in shaping economic, foreign and security policy in the EU has been raised,
